Being a man in the 21st century

Today is International Men’s Day. A day that few men around the world know or care about. Partly because it is less publicised than the corresponding International Women’s Day and partly because men universally are too ‘selfless’ to dedicate a whole day to their well-being.

The world is changing. While in the past, the world revolved around men — as providers, protectors and generally fending for the family - presently these very roles are easily done by women.
